West Virginia SB99 mandates updates to the child welfare data dashboard and establishes procedures for handling child abuse and neglect reports.
West Virginia SB99 requires the commissioner to update the child welfare data dashboard by July 1, 2026, and monthly thereafter. The dashboard will report on system-wide issues, performance indicators, and data on child fatalities and near fatalities. The bill mandates that the Bureau of Social Services respond to all reports of child abuse and neglect, regardless of how they are made. It also requires the Bureau to use a system of differential response to reports received by centralized intake, using appropriate screening tools.
